From ad9cbfbc8001a2b36fe6bef0ae2d16af7aefebbb Mon Sep 17 00:00:00 2001 From: Abhijeet Kaur Date: Tue, 9 Jun 2020 16:20:11 +0100 Subject: [PATCH] Remove getFreeBytes() to fasten queryRoots call. This change fastens the first call to DocumentsUI after reboot. Bug: 155819706 Test: builds (fastens the first call to DocumentsUI by 600-800ms) Change-Id: Id8396e36ed8aa1ded79d93a2f1ed140bf903184b --- .../com/android/externalstorage/ExternalStorageProvider.java |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/packages/ExternalStorageProvider/src/com/android/externalstorage/ExternalStorageProvider.java b/packages/ExternalStorageProvider/src/com/android/externalstorage/ExternalStorageProvider.java index 8f919c3d86cae..360b14d97158d 100644 --- a/packages/ExternalStorageProvider/src/com/android/externalstorage/ExternalStorageProvider.java +++ b/packages/ExternalStorageProvider/src/com/android/externalstorage/ExternalStorageProvider.java @@ -95,7 +95,8 @@ public class ExternalStorageProvider extends FileSystemProvider { public String docId; public File visiblePath; public File path; - public boolean reportAvailableBytes = true; + // TODO (b/157033915): Make getFreeBytes() faster + public boolean reportAvailableBytes = false; } private static final String ROOT_ID_PRIMARY_EMULATED =